Essential Functions

Music Direction:

  • Responsible for music direction & maintenance for song rotations & imaging for key HMG brands. This includes:
  • Continually pursue understanding the local radio audience vs the national audience consumption.
  • Screening new music and making recommendations for music rotations.
  • Prep & organize research for weekly music meetings
  • Lead label relationships, including music tracking & logistics for artist appearances, interviews etc.
  • Preparing daily music and program logs for KSBJ and Way FM. This includes:
  • Loading, scheduling, managing metadata and rotations of imaging/promos in G Selector.
  • Ensure promo counts are accurate for different departmental needs.
  • Preparing & integrating music research projects.
  • Compile music data for both KSBJ and WAY FM This includes:
  • Maintaining updated music research spreadsheets.
  • Compile music data from research resources & consumption reports to build stories for future music trends.
  • Oversees Word of Hope, Word on the Way, Community Beat/Vignettes and and reconcile weekend logs.
  • Lead the KSBJ music panel Facebook page.
  • Primary contact to handle G Selector and/or Zetta issues whenever they occur, problem solving with engineering and RCS support.

Requirements:

Education:

  • High School Diploma or GED equivalent required; bachelor's degree preferred

Experience:

  • 5–7 years of professional radio experience, with at least 3 years in Programming (PD, MD, and/or APD) and on-air.
  • Hands-on knowledge of music scheduling and automation systems (G-Selector, Zetta), plus experience with Adobe Audition, Windows OS, and Microsoft Office.
  • Familiarity with music research and audience testing (music surveys, AMTs) and on-air fundraising/support drives is a strong plus.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:

  • A strategic understanding of Contemporary Christian Music, its audience, and its evolving role in culture.
  • Deep insight into the distinct audiences of KSBJ and WayFM - and how music selection should reflect and serve each one differently.
  • Comfortable navigating the legal and technical aspects of radio broadcasting.
  • Expertise in music programming fundamentals: music clocks, rotations, log editing, and data analysis.
  • Strong working knowledge of programming software - and the curiosity to stay ahead of new tools and trends.
  • Ability to build and maintain relationships with record labels and industry partners.
  • An instinctive sense of quality control, detail orientation, and a commitment to getting things right.
  • A creative mind with the discipline to manage time, hit deadlines, and juggle priorities.
  • Strong communicator, both written and verbal, with the ability to lead, mentor, and inspire team members.
  • Team player and collaborator, excited to co-create and innovate across departments and platforms.
  • A servant leader’s heart: humble, joyful, helpful, and committed to excellence.
  • Spiritually mature, with a vibrant personal relationship with Jesus Christ, active in a Bible-believing church, and grounded in Christian values and biblical truth.
  • Willing and available to serve beyond regular hours when needed—including nights, weekends, holidays, and emergencies.
